Description
A truly characterful home - Beautifully presented, four bedroom palisaded Victorian terrace property of style and character, benefitting from a private walled garden, located within the noted Six Streets area.

The property is nicely positioned set well back from Kedleston Road along the attractive tree lined Statham Street area. It is constructed of brick, beneath a pitched tiled roof with the front elevation having an attractive appearance revealed by a superb ground floor bay window, stone lintel and sills and matching period style sealed unit double glazed sash style windows. A quarry pathway leads to the entrance door which has stained glass with leaded finish.

An internal inspection will reveal a well maintained, gas central heating living accommodation and briefly consists on the ground floor; entrance vestibule with original Minton tiled flooring, entrance hall with original Minton tiled flooring and staircase leading to the first floor, cloakroom with WC, charming lounge with feature period fireplace, separate dining room with feature period fireplace and a well appointed kitchen/diner with built in appliances and granite worktops. The first floor passageway landing leads to four generous bedrooms and a fitted period style bathroom in white white shower.

To the rear of the property, there is a private walled enclosed rear garden laid to lawn with paved patio and useful brick store.

The property does offer excellent potential for a loft conversion (subject to planning permission).
